Denim Shorts With Real Style Mileage

The jorts revival feels decidedly different this time around. With longer hems, relaxed legs, and a sharper eye for proportion, men’s denim shorts have graduated from novelty to everyday staple. Editors, stylists, and shoppers alike are embracing knee-skimming silhouettes that signal confidence rather than carelessness. Major outlets have taken note as well, tracking how once-mocked, oversized jorts have evolved from punchline to credible style move for men—spotted on runways, sidewalks, and social feeds alike.

What sets this resurgence apart is its balance of comfort and attitude. Writers highlight a new, slouchy elegance and an inclusive fit that works across sizes and ages, while product roundups confirm strong retail traction from heritage brands and emerging labels. Even skeptics have become converts after experiencing the ease of roomier cuts, whether finished or raw at the hem. Far from a fleeting microtrend, today’s jorts mark the return of a practical piece for men, reimagined with modern clarity.

Men’s Denim Shorts: A Reputation Rewritten

For years, men’s jorts carried cultural baggage. They were shorthand for dadcore clichés, campus nostalgia, and weekend yard work. Fashion moved on, only to circle back with a sharper lens. Today’s versions sit lower on irony and higher on design—longer on the thigh, often brushing the knee, with clean rises and measured volume through the leg. Fashion journalists now frame the look as part of a broader swing toward androgynous ease and a rejection of overly polished dress codes, which explains why the silhouette reads considered rather than comedic.

With that context in mind, styling men’s jorts becomes less about irony and more about intention. Treat them like true denim, not novelty wear. Lean into length for structure, keep washes minimal, and let the cut do the talking. A mid-to-dark wash anchors smarter pairings, while a classic mid-rise keeps proportions grounded. For versatility, start with a five-pocket cut in sturdy cotton that softens with time—a choice that matters, since reviewers consistently highlight how quality denim both breaks in beautifully and holds its shape.

Why Men’s Jorts Returned Now

Two forces have propelled men’s denim shorts into the present. First, fashion’s broader pivot toward ease. Wide-leg jeans, relaxed trousers, and oversized jackets set the stage, making a longer short with room to breathe feel inevitable. Enter the knee-grazing jort: a cooler counterpart to heavy denim that still carries the clean lines we now prefer. Second, nostalgia returned with restraint. Fashion editors describe the trend as reflective rather than ironic, noting how the cut’s balance of memory and refinement makes it not only relevant but wearable across a wide range of bodies.

Celebrity influence and retail momentum have sealed the deal. Coverage tracks how style leaders and pop culture moments legitimized the silhouette, while shopping roundups spotlight accessible options across price points. From premium labels to mass retailers, the market is stacked with longer inseams and relaxed legs. That breadth signals something bigger: jorts have officially graduated from novelty status to bona fide staple in men’s wardrobes.  

Fit, Fabric, and Length

The modern denim shorts for men live or die by proportion. A slightly relaxed seat paired with a straight, roomy leg creates the cleanest line, while inseams that hit between mid-thigh and knee offer the most versatility. Many editors praise the confidence and coverage of longer cuts, and fabric choice only sharpens the effect. Sturdy non-stretch or minimal-stretch denim that softens with wear consistently performs best, with first-person tests noting how a roomy thigh eliminates cling and chafing—a detail that explains the loyalty of new converts.

It’s the details, however, that refine the silhouette. Finished hems read tidy alongside loafers or sleek sneakers, while raw hems lean casual and pair easily with retro runners. A mid-wash in a classic five-pocket shape feels timeless; a darker wash tilts more polished when styled with a crisp button-down. For structure, opt for heavier-weight denim that resists collapsing at the knee. For movement, lighter-weight fabric drapes without sacrificing presence. With retail guides surfacing both options in abundance, striking the right balance is less about luck and more about preference.

How to Style Men’s Denim Shorts With Intention

Start simple. A crisp tee tucked just enough to reveal the waistband adds shape and reins in the leg volume. Layer on a short chore jacket or cropped bomber to define the frame, or, on warmer days, switch to an open Oxford over a tank. The aim is clarity—clean lines up top, relaxed structure below. And when polish is the priority, a lightweight blazer over a knit polo sharpens the look without disrupting the jort’s ease. Fashion editors and stylists alike emphasize that proportion play is what separates deliberate from sloppy.

Footwear locks in the result. Minimal leather sneakers keep the vibe modern, while retro runners inject energy without overwhelming the look. For a sharper edge, loafers paired with socks that echo your top add subtle coherence. Accessories should be purposeful: think slim belt, quiet watch, small crossbody bag. Style writers who’ve road-tested longer shorts consistently land on the same conclusion—once the leg line is dialed in, the rest of the outfit falls neatly into place.

Final Take

Jorts 2.0 succeed because they respect both the body and the outfit. The longer cut projects confidence, the relaxed leg unlocks movement, and the denim itself grounds everything in familiarity. Media coverage and shopper reviews point to a rare consensus: people genuinely like wearing them—and just as importantly, they like how they look while living real life. That blend of practicality and presence is hard to dismiss.

Think of them less as a seasonal stunt and more as a smart addition to the rotation. With the right fabric, length, and proportion, jorts occupy the same style lanes as your best jeans and tailored trousers. They deliver a clear silhouette, a modern attitude, and a surprising amount of range. Build the outfit with intention, then step back and let the denim do the talking.
